We have very large prickly weeds in our flower beds. They are growing in between bushes.How can we rid the beds of these weeds. This is the second year that they have come up in the beds. I have pulled them out by hand but would like to permanently get rid of them. |
Sounds like thistle and these perennial weeds are very difficult to eradicate. While the tops die down in the winter, the roots remain alive and resprout each spring. Digging them out, roots and all is the best approach. Once you've done that you can cover over the bare earth between the shrubs with a thick mulch to help exclude light which will keep any seeds from germinating. Best wishes with your flower bed. |
